Meta Fixes Instagram Bug That Let Hackers Take Over Accounts

A flaw in Meta's new artificial intelligence software allowed anyone to take over Instagram accounts. The company said it has fixed the issue.

A software flaw in Meta's new artificial intelligence tools let unauthorized users take control of Instagram accounts. The company said the bug has been fixed. No further details on the number of accounts affected were released.

Background on the Issue The vulnerability was tied to the company's recently introduced artificial intelligence software. Meta stated that the flaw allowed account takeovers without user action. The company did not provide information on how long the bug existed before detection.
